Complaint about shots fired turns into drug charges for Eddyville man

An Eddyville man is facing multiple drug-related charges after deputies responded to a report of shots fired on Friday afternoon.

The Lyon County Sheriff’s office and Kentucky State troopers responded to a residence on Friendship Road. A search uncovered two handguns, methamphetamine, marijuana and pills.

Deputies arrested 64-year-old Earl B. Molloy on charges of possession of a handgun by a convicted felon, trafficking in a controlled substance and possession of meth.

Molloy was taken to the Crittenden County Detention Center.
